Chain link fences have evolved tremendously over the years, and this can be a fence just for general purposes. Most people don't want something that is very tall or unattractive, and some chain link metal fences are totally dull, boring, and not at all attractive. But for the boundary type of fence, take a look at the split rail or just rail fence, and you've seen these and they're made from a few different kinds of wood. You can even get oak fences, and they're nice but be prepared for some sticker shock. If you are not quite decided on materials, then work to maintain an open mind.

If you want to do more with your fence, or have it serve more than one purpose, then the ornamental type of fencing is in order. You should at least shop for it and go and check it out first hand, also, what you see in pictures on the web as compared to in-person is just different. What will make or break your deal are usually the materials because they are not all made to the same standards. Either way, the ornamental fence will add a very nice and attractive touch to your property and you'll be happy with it.

The standard security fence will usually be no higher than eight feet and six feet on the lower spec. Go on the net and find out if you have to get a permit for a higher fence. Just call your town or state office for permits applicable to home improvements and they can tell you right away.
